iommu: Move lock from iommu_change_dev_def_domain() to its caller
authorLu Baolu <baolu.lu@linux.intel.com>
Wed, 22 Mar 2023 06:49:54 +0000 (14:49 +0800)
committerJoerg Roedel <jroedel@suse.de>
Wed, 22 Mar 2023 14:45:17 +0000 (15:45 +0100)
The intention is to make it possible to put group ownership check and
default domain change in a same critical region protected by the group's
mutex lock. No intentional functional change.
